Mate of mine has a B6 Passat PD140 and it broke down yesterday leaving his missus and 3 month old stuck on the motorway. breakdown service just towed it home. Popped in and checked for error codes this morning for him - just one 01314 -036 ECM sporadic communications. Googling shows this is quite easy to generate just with a failed start. No other codes.

It does start, takes a fair amount of cranking - which doesn't feel smooth, and then feels like it is miss firing. Any thoughts on the problem? One of my thoughts was a failed injector - he called his local garage who said unplug the Air flow meter and try to start it. He will try that later but the symptoms seem a bit extreme to me for that.

Anything sound familiar to others? or any ideas?

Scoop940
29-07-2010, 10:01 AM
Fuel Pump apparently, and there was a recall on this car for it that was never done. VW now fixing FOC.
